What is the Child and Adult Care Food Program Enrollment Form?
The Child and Adult Care Food Program Enrollment Form is a vital document for enrolling children in the CACFP in Oklahoma. This form serves to collect essential information from families, ensuring that children receive proper nutrition through collective support from child and adult care providers. Understanding the significance of this enrollment form is crucial for each participating family and provider.

Key Features of the Child and Adult Care Food Program Enrollment Form
This enrollment form includes various features that facilitate a straightforward user experience. Key components consist of:
-
Fillable fields such as Child’s Name, Date of Birth, and Normal Days in Attendance.
-
Checkboxes designed to indicate Special Dietary Needs and Normal Meals Eaten.
-
A designated section for the parent or guardian’s signature, ensuring accountability and completion.
These features simplify documentation while catering to specific needs.

Who is eligible to fill out the Child and Adult Care Food Program Enrollment Form?
Eligibility to fill out the form primarily includes parents or guardians of children who are enrolled in the Child and Adult Care Food Program in Oklahoma.
What is the deadline for submitting the Enrollment Form?
Typically, the Enrollment Form should be submitted annually or when there are changes to the child's dietary needs or attendance. Check with your local CACFP office for specific deadlines.
How do I submit the completed Enrollment Form?
You can submit the completed form through pdfFiller by sending it electronically or print it out for hand delivery to your child care provider or Head Start facility.
What supporting documents are required with the Enrollment Form?
A signed medical statement is required if the child has special dietary needs. Ensure this document is prepared and attached when submitting the form.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include failing to include a parent or guardian's signature, not checking the necessary dietary options, and leaving required fields blank.
How long does it take to process the Enrollment Form?
Processing times can vary based on the organization handling it. However, it may take a few days to confirm enrollment once submitted.
Are there any fees associated with filling out the Enrollment Form?
There are typically no fees for filling out and submitting the Enrollment Form. However, it's recommended to confirm if your specific child care facility has any additional costs.
